We are looking for a Team Lead to manage and grow a mobile engineering team responsible for building and evolving the mobile foundations of TeamViewer Frontline. You will work closely with other R&D leaders and contribute to department-wide initiatives while shaping how mobile technologies and SDKs are used across our ecosystem.
This role combines strong people leadership with deep technical understanding of Android and/or Kotlin Multiplatform technologies, focusing on building reusable SDKs, integrating APIs, and enabling multiple teams to build mobile solutions on top of a shared foundation.

Requirements
University or college degree in Information Technology or a related field
2+ years in a leadership role in an agile environment
5+ years of software development experience with strong focus on Android and/or Kotlin Multiplatform
Solid experience building and maintaining mobile SDKs and integrating REST/GraphQL APIs in Android applications
Strong understanding of Android architecture, app lifecycle, threading, networking, and performance optimization
Experience with Kotlin, Coroutines, Flow, and modern Android development practices
Knowledge of clean code principles, design patterns, and scalable architecture for mobile applications
Understanding of security, network communication, and offline/online synchronization patterns
Structured, analytical working style and strong team spirit
Excellent English communication skills (spoken and written). German is a plus
